People & Culture Assistant (Apprenticeship)
2 weeks ago
We are looking for a People & Culture Assistant to join the People & Culture team at Thermatic Group.This is an apprenticeship and the postholder will undertake an HR Support Level 3 apprenticeship as part of this role.This role is a fixed‑term contract based on the length of the apprenticeship (approx. 18 months).The People & Culture Assistant will support the day‑to‑day delivery of HR operations across the business while undertaking a Level 3 HR Support apprenticeship. Working closely with the People & Culture Partner and Advisors, this role provides administrative and operational support across employee lifecycle activities, HR systems, digital process improvements, onboarding, and employee engagement. The role offers hands‑on experience in a fast‑paced FM environment and builds foundational HR knowledge, skills, and behaviours for future progression.Thermatic Technical FM provides complete nationwide coverage across the full spectrum of Hard FM services to large, commercial clients.
